TANIMLAR<\/h4>\n<h6>1.1. SET SAYISI<\/h6>\n<p>Melbes uygulamas\u0131nda Emisyon ve \u0130misyon, G\u00fcr\u00fclt\u00fc, Titre\u015fim ve S\u00fcrekli Emisyon kapsam\u0131nda set say\u0131lar\u0131 laboratuvar\u0131n kapasitesini belirlemek i\u00e7in kullan\u0131l\u0131r. Set say\u0131lar\u0131n\u0131n belirlenmesinde, laboratuvar\u0131n her parametre i\u00e7in \u00f6rnekleme ve numune alma cihazlar\u0131 ile laboratuvar\u0131n o kapsamda yetkili \u00f6l\u00e7\u00fcm &amp; \u00f6rnekleme personeli ele al\u0131n\u0131r. Bu iki de\u011ferden minimum olan\u0131<br \/>\nlaboratuvar\u0131n o parametre i\u00e7in set say\u0131s\u0131n\u0131 verir. \u00d6rne\u011fin Toz parametresi i\u00e7in 4 \u00f6l\u00e7\u00fcm cihaz\u0131 olan ve 3 adet Emisyon \u00f6l\u00e7\u00fcm personeli bulunan bir laboratuvar\u0131n Toz parametresi i\u00e7in set say\u0131s\u0131 3 olarak belirlenir.<br \/>\nEmisyon ve \u0130misyon, G\u00fcr\u00fclt\u00fc, Titre\u015fim ve S\u00fcrekli Emisyon kapsamlar\u0131nda set say\u0131s\u0131 maksimum 5 olabilir.At\u0131k Su, Su, Deniz Suyu, Koku, Toprak, At\u0131k Ya\u011f ve Ar\u0131tma \u00c7amuru kapsamlar\u0131 i\u00e7in t\u00fcm parametrelerin set say\u0131s\u0131 her bir laboratuvar i\u00e7in 1 olarak de\u011ferlendirilir.<br \/>\nTemel Puan ve Ba\u015fvuru D\u00fczeltme Puanlar\u0131n\u0131n hesaplanmas\u0131 esnas\u0131nda parametre set say\u0131lar\u0131 kullan\u0131l\u0131r. TECR\u00dcBE KATSAYISI<\/h6>\n<p>Tecr\u00fcbeden gelen katsay\u0131 de\u011feri hesaplan\u0131rken a\u015fa\u011f\u0131daki tablo kullan\u0131l\u0131r. Tecr\u00fcbe de\u011feri belirlenirken, laboratuvarlar\u0131n ilk belge tarihleri kullan\u0131lm\u0131\u015ft\u0131r. A\u015fa\u011f\u0131daki tabloda verilen log(tecr\u00fcbe, 100000) fonksiyonunda 100000 de\u011feri, log fonksiyonun taban de\u011ferini, tecr\u00fcbe de\u011feri de log fonksiyonun \u00fcs de\u011ferini ifade etmektedir.<\/p>\n<p><img data-recalc-dims=\"1\" lo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-full wp-image-3933\" src=\"https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=1091%2C364&#038;ssl=1\" alt=\"\" width=\"1091\" height=\"364\" srcset=\"https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?w=1091&amp;ssl=1 1091w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=300%2C100&amp;ssl=1 300w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=1024%2C342&amp;ssl=1 1024w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=768%2C256&amp;ssl=1 768w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=860%2C287&amp;ssl=1 860w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=680%2C227&amp;ssl=1 680w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=500%2C167&amp;ssl=1 500w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=400%2C133&amp;ssl=1 400w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=250%2C83&amp;ssl=1 250w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=200%2C67&amp;ssl=1 200w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=100%2C33&amp;ssl=1 100w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=76%2C25&amp;ssl=1 76w, https:\/\/i0.wp.com\/ilkercivil.com\/staging\/wp-content\/uploads\/2020\/06\/melbes-algoritma-tablo-3.png?resize=50%2C17&amp;ssl=1 50w\" sizes=\"auto, (max-width: 1000px) 100vw, 1000px\" \/><\/p>\n<p>Tecr\u00fcbe de\u011feri maksimum 10 y\u0131l olabilmektedir. Laboratuvar\u0131n tecr\u00fcbe de\u011feri 10\u2019a ula\u015ft\u0131ktan sonra tecr\u00fcbe katsay\u0131s\u0131 0,4 olarak sabitlenmektedir. 3 ve 10 y\u0131l aras\u0131 tecr\u00fcbeli laboratuvarlar\u0131n katsay\u0131s\u0131 hesaplan\u0131rken 0,2 de\u011feri \u00fczerine log(tecr\u00fcbe y\u0131l\u0131, 100000) fonksiyonunun sonucu eklenir. \u00d6rne\u011fin, 3 y\u0131ll\u0131k tecr\u00fcbesi olan bir laboratuvar\u0131n katsay\u0131s\u0131, 0,2 + log(3, 100000) = 0,29 olarak hesaplan\u0131r. 4 y\u0131l tecr\u00fcbeli bir laboratuvar\u0131n katsay\u0131s\u0131 da 0,2 + log(4, 100000) = 0,32 olarak hesaplan\u0131r. log(10, 100000) sonucu 0,2 oldu\u011fundan, 10 y\u0131ll\u0131k tecr\u00fcbeye sahip bir laboratuvar\u0131n tecr\u00fcbe katsay\u0131s\u0131 0,4 olarak hesaplan\u0131r.<\/p>\n<h6>1.2.1.2. PERSONEL SAYISI KATSAYISI<\/h6>\n<p>Bu katsay\u0131 hesaplan\u0131rken laboratuvar\u0131n sertifikal\u0131 numune alma personeli ve analiz personeli say\u0131lar\u0131 kullan\u0131l\u0131r. Personel hem numune alma personeli hem de analiz personeli olarak beyan edildiyse, bu ki\u015fi bir defa hesaplamaya kat\u0131l\u0131r. Bu katsay\u0131n\u0131n hesaplanmas\u0131nda kullan\u0131lan personel say\u0131s\u0131 maksimum 20 olabilir.<br \/>\nKatsay\u0131 hesaplan\u0131rken log(toplam personel say\u0131s\u0131, 20) x 0,4 form\u00fclasyonu kullan\u0131l\u0131r. Bu hesaplamaya g\u00f6re 20 personeli olan bir laboratuvar\u0131n personel katsay\u0131s\u0131 1 x 0,4 = 0,4, 10 personeli olan bir laboratuvar\u0131n da 0,76 x 0,4 = 0,3 olarak hesaplan\u0131r.<\/p>\n<h6>1.2.1.3. PARAMETRE KATSAYISI<\/h6>\n<p>Bu katsay\u0131 hesaplan\u0131rken ve laboratuvar\u0131n ilgili kapsamdaki parametre say\u0131s\u0131n\u0131n, Bakanl\u0131k taraf\u0131ndan ilgili kapsamda yetki verilen toplam parametre say\u0131s\u0131na oran\u0131 kullan\u0131l\u0131r.<br \/>\n\u00d6rne\u011fin, At\u0131k Su kapsam\u0131nda 1748 parametre i\u00e7in yetki verilmektedir. At\u0131k Su kapsam\u0131nda 500 parametreden yetkisi olan bir laboratuvar\u0131n, at\u0131k su parametre katsay\u0131s\u0131 (500 \/ 1748) x 0,2 = 0,05 olarak hesaplan\u0131r.<\/p>\n<h6>1.2.2. TEMEL PUAN<\/h4>\n<p>Her laboratuvar ba\u015fvuruda yer alan parametreler, parametrelerin adetleri, ilgili parametrelere kar\u015f\u0131l\u0131k gelen set say\u0131lar\u0131 ve laboratuvar\u0131n ba\u015fvuru kapsam\u0131 katsay\u0131s\u0131 kullan\u0131larak temel puan\u0131 hesaplan\u0131r. Emisyon ve \u0130misyon, G\u00fcr\u00fclt\u00fc, Titre\u015fim ve S\u00fcrekli Emisyon kapsamlar\u0131 d\u0131\u015f\u0131ndaki kapsamlarda set say\u0131s\u0131 bulunmamaktad\u0131r. Bu kapsamlar i\u00e7in her bir parametrenin set say\u0131s\u0131 bir 1 olarak de\u011ferlendirilir.<br \/>\n\u00d6rne\u011fin, VOC ve Toz parametrelerinin oldu\u011fu bir ba\u015fvuruda VOC parametresinin numune alma fiyat\u0131, VOC \u00f6l\u00e7\u00fclecek kaynak say\u0131s\u0131 ve laboratuvar\u0131n VOC set say\u0131s\u0131 \u00e7arp\u0131l\u0131r. Bu hesaplamadan VOC parametresinin \u00f6rnekleme k\u0131sm\u0131 i\u00e7in bir puan elde edilir. Ayn\u0131 i\u015flem analiz k\u0131sm\u0131 i\u00e7in de analiz fiyat\u0131 kullan\u0131larak ger\u00e7ekle\u015ftirilir. Analiz hesaplamalar\u0131nda set say\u0131s\u0131 \u00f6rnekleme set say\u0131s\u0131ndan ba\u011f\u0131ms\u0131z olarak 1 olarak ele al\u0131n\u0131r. Bu iki tutar toplanarak laboratuvar\u0131n VOC parametresi puan\u0131 elde edilir. Ayn\u0131 i\u015flem Toz parametresi i\u00e7in de ger\u00e7ekle\u015ftirilir. Sonu\u00e7 olarak, VOC puan\u0131 ve Toz puan\u0131 toplanarak t\u00fcm parametrelerden gelen puan elde edilir.<br \/>\nElde edilen bu puan, laboratuvar\u0131n ba\u015fvuru kapsam\u0131ndaki katsay\u0131s\u0131 ile \u00e7arp\u0131larak laboratuvar\u0131n temel puan\u0131 elde edilir.<br \/>\nLaboratuvar\u0131n \u00f6rnekleme ve analiz olarak iki par\u00e7adan olu\u015fan parametreler i\u00e7in analiz yetkisi yok ise, analiz k\u0131sm\u0131 set say\u0131s\u0131 0 olarak ele al\u0131n\u0131r ve Laboratuvar analiz k\u0131s\u0131mdan puan elde edemez.<\/p>\n<h4>1.4. \u0130\u015e B\u0130RL\u0130\u011e\u0130 ORANI<\/h4>\n<p>\u0130\u015f birli\u011fi oran\u0131 ba\u015fvuruda yer alan parametreler ve parametrelerin adetleri g\u00f6z \u00f6n\u00fcne al\u0131narak hesaplan\u0131r. Parametrelerin tutarlar\u0131 hesaplamaya kat\u0131lmaz. \u00d6rne\u011fin, 2 VOC, 1 Toz ve 2 Yanma Gaz\u0131 olan bir ba\u015fvuru laboratuvar\u0131n i\u015f birli\u011fi oran\u0131 hesaplan\u0131rken, her parametrenin i\u015flem say\u0131s\u0131 da g\u00f6z \u00f6n\u00fcne al\u0131n\u0131r. \u00d6rne\u011fin VOC parametresinin \u00f6rnekleme ve analizini yapamayan bir laboratuvar i\u015f birli\u011fi oran\u0131 100 &#8211; ((1 + 2) \/ 5) x 100 = %40 olarak hesaplan\u0131r.<br \/>\nVOC parametresinin sadece \u00f6rneklemesini yapan bir laboratuvar\u0131n i\u015f birli\u011fi oran\u0131 ise, 100 &#8211; ((1+ 1 + 2) \/ 5) x 100 = %20 olarak hesaplan\u0131r. \u0130lk hesaplamadan farkl\u0131 olarak laboratuvar VOC i\u015flemlerinin yar\u0131s\u0131n\u0131 ger\u00e7ekle\u015ftirebilmektedir. Bu nedenle hesaplamaya 2 VOC i\u015fleminin yar\u0131s\u0131 olan 1 VOC i\u015flemi de kat\u0131l\u0131r.<\/p>\n<h4>1.5. B\u0130R\u0130M SET TUTARI<\/h4>\n<p>Birim set tutarlar\u0131 her ba\u015fvurunun atanmas\u0131 esnas\u0131nda ba\u015fvuruda yer alan t\u00fcm parametreler i\u00e7in hesaplan\u0131r. Bu tutar laboratuvar\u0131n d\u00fczeltme puan\u0131n\u0131n hesaplanmas\u0131nda kullan\u0131l\u0131r.<br \/>\nBirim set tutar\u0131 bir parametrenin t\u00fcm i\u015flemleri i\u00e7in hesaplan\u0131r. \u00d6rne\u011fin, VOC parametresi i\u00e7in \u00f6rnekleme k\u0131sm\u0131 i\u00e7in bir birim set tutar\u0131, analiz k\u0131sm\u0131 i\u00e7in ayr\u0131 bir birim set tutar\u0131 hesaplan\u0131r. Analiz k\u0131sm\u0131 i\u00e7in, analiz yetkisi olan t\u00fcm laboratuvarlar\u0131n set say\u0131s\u0131 1 olarak de\u011ferlendirilir. \u00d6rnekleme k\u0131sm\u0131 i\u00e7in ise set say\u0131lar\u0131 kullan\u0131l\u0131r.<br \/>\n\u00d6rne\u011fin, 2019 y\u0131l\u0131nda VOC parametresinin \u00f6rnekleme k\u0131sm\u0131ndan 265.000,00 TL tutar\u0131nda, analiz k\u0131sm\u0131ndan da 920.000,00 TL tutar\u0131nda i\u015f da\u011f\u0131t\u0131ld\u0131\u011f\u0131n\u0131 ele alal\u0131m. Birim set say\u0131lar\u0131n\u0131 hesaplamak i\u00e7in VOC parametresinin analizinden yetkili laboratuvarlar\u0131n say\u0131s\u0131na bak\u0131l\u0131r. 100 adet analiz k\u0131sm\u0131ndan yetkili laboratuvar varsa, VOC parametresinin analiz k\u0131sm\u0131 i\u00e7in birim set tutar\u0131 920000 \/ 100 = 9200 TL olarak hesaplan\u0131r.<\/p>\n<p>\u00d6rnekleme k\u0131sm\u0131 da benzer bir hesaplama ile yap\u0131l\u0131r fakat burada set say\u0131lar\u0131 da kullan\u0131l\u0131r. Her laboratuvar\u0131n VOC set say\u0131lar\u0131 toplan\u0131r ve Toplam VOC set say\u0131s\u0131 elde edilir. \u00d6rne\u011fin, Emisyon kapsam\u0131nda yetkili t\u00fcm laboratuvarlar\u0131n set say\u0131s\u0131n\u0131n 300 oldu\u011fu bir durumda, 265000 \/ 300 = 883 TL VOC \u00f6rnekleme birim set tutar\u0131 elde edilir. Bunun anlam\u0131 1 seti olan bir laboratuvar\u0131n 883 TL tutar\u0131nda VOC \u00f6rnekleme i\u015fi, 2 seti olan bir laboratuvar\u0131n ise 883 TL x 2 = 1766 TL tutar\u0131nda VOC \u00f6rnekleme i\u015fi almas\u0131 gerekti\u011fidir. Elde edilen birim set tutarlar\u0131, d\u00fczeltme puan\u0131n\u0131n hesaplamas\u0131nda kullan\u0131l\u0131r.<\/p>\n<h4>1.7. BA\u015eVURU D\u00dcZELTME PUANI<\/h4>\n<p>,D\u00fczeltme puan\u0131 hesaplan\u0131rken ba\u015fvuruda yer alan her parametre i\u00e7in birim set tutar\u0131 hesaplan\u0131r. Birim set tutarlar\u0131 laboratuvar\u0131n set say\u0131s\u0131 (analiz k\u0131s\u0131mlar\u0131 i\u00e7in 1 ile \u00e7arp\u0131l\u0131r) ve ba\u015fvuru kapsam\u0131 katsay\u0131s\u0131 ile \u00e7arp\u0131larak laboratuvar\u0131n parametre baz\u0131nda alm\u0131\u015f olmas\u0131 gereken tutar hesaplan\u0131r. Bu tutarlar parametre baz\u0131nda laboratuvar\u0131n ald\u0131\u011f\u0131 tutarlar ile kar\u015f\u0131la\u015ft\u0131r\u0131l\u0131r ve laboratuvar\u0131n ba\u015fvuruya \u00f6zel d\u00fczeltme puan\u0131 hesaplan\u0131r. \u00d6rne\u011fin, VOC parametresinden 50.000 TL tutar\u0131nda i\u015f alm\u0131\u015f olmas\u0131 gereken, Toz parametresinden de 10.000 TL tutar\u0131nda i\u015f alm\u0131\u015f olmas\u0131 gereken bir laboratuvar\u0131 ele alal\u0131m. Laboratuvar VOC parametresinden toplam 45.000 TL, Toz parametresinden de 12.500 TL tutar\u0131nda i\u015f ald\u0131ysa, VOC parametresi d\u00fczeltme puan\u0131 5.000 TL, Toz parametresi d\u00fczeltme puan\u0131 -2.500 TL olarak hesaplan\u0131r. Bu iki de\u011fer toplanarak laboratuvar\u0131n Toz ve VOC i\u00e7eren bir ba\u015fvuru i\u00e7in d\u00fczeltme puan\u0131 hesaplanm\u0131\u015f olur.<\/p>\n<h4>1.8. BA\u015eVURU DA\u011eITIM ALGOR\u0130TMALARI<\/h4>\n<h6>2.1. EM\u0130SYON VE \u0130M\u0130SYON BA\u015eVURUSU DA\u011eITIMI<\/h6>\n<p>2.1.1. Ba\u015fvuru kapsam\u0131nda yetkisi olan t\u00fcm laboratuvarlar se\u00e7ilir.<\/p>\n<p>2.1.2. Tesisin bulundu\u011fu il i\u00e7in g\u00f6revlendirilmek istemeyen laboratuvarlar belirlenir. Bu laboratuvarlar hesaplamalara kat\u0131lmaz.<\/p>\n<p>2.1.3. \u0130lgili kapsamda g\u00f6revlendirilmek istenmeyen laboratuvarlar belirlenir. Bu laboratuvarlar hesaplamalara kat\u0131lmaz.<\/p>\n<p>2.1.4. Ba\u015fvuru yap\u0131l\u0131rken, ex-proof se\u00e7ene\u011fi i\u015faretlendiyse, ex-proof hizmet verebilen laboratuvarlar belirlenir. Yapamayan laboratuvarlar hesaplamaya kat\u0131lmaz.<\/p>\n<p>2.1.5. Ba\u015fvurunun sadece \u0130misyon parametrelerini i\u00e7erip, i\u00e7erilmedi\u011fi kontrol edilir. Sadece \u0130misyon parametrelerini i\u00e7eren ba\u015fvurular i\u00e7in, tesise en fazla 4 saat i\u00e7inde ula\u015fabilecek laboratuvarlar belirlenir. Di\u011fer laboratuvarlar hesaplamaya kat\u0131lmaz. Bu s\u00fcre i\u00e7inde laboratuvara ula\u015fabilecek laboratuvar bulunamazsa, bu kriter g\u00f6z ard\u0131 edilir.<\/p>\n<p>2.1.6. Laboratuvarlar\u0131n i\u015f birli\u011fi oranlar\u0131 hesaplan\u0131r. \u0130\u015f birli\u011fi oran\u0131 %30\u2019dan fazla olan laboratuvarlar hesaplamaya kat\u0131lmaz.<\/p>\n<p>2.1.7. Laboratuvarlar\u0131n temel puanlar\u0131 hesaplan\u0131r.<\/p>\n<p>2.1.8. Laboratuvarlar\u0131n tesise olan ula\u015f\u0131m s\u00fcreleri hesaplan\u0131r. Laboratuvarlar\u0131n tesise ulan ula\u015f\u0131m s\u00fcresi kullan\u0131larak, ula\u015f\u0131m s\u00fcresinden kaybedilen puanlar hesaplan\u0131r.<\/p>\n<p>2.1.9. Laboratuvarlar\u0131n ba\u015fvuruya \u00f6zel d\u00fczeltme puanlar\u0131 hesaplan\u0131r.<\/p>\n<p>2.1.10. Laboratuvarlar\u0131n kapsam baz\u0131nda sapma tutarlar\u0131 hesaplan\u0131r.<\/p>\n<p>2.1.11. Laboratuvarlar\u0131n ceza puanlar\u0131 hesaplan\u0131r.<\/p>\n<p>2.1.12. Ba\u015fvuruda dioksin ve furan parametresi varsa, laboratuvarlar\u0131n dioksin furan analizi yapabilen laboratuvarlar belirlenir.<\/p>\n<p>2.1.13. Laboratuvar\u0131n temel puan\u0131 (pozitif), d\u00fczeltme puan\u0131 (pozitif veya negatif), uzakl\u0131ktan kaybetti\u011fi puan (negatif) ve ceza puan\u0131 (negatif) toplanarak laboratuvar\u0131n son puan\u0131 elde edilir.<\/p>\n<p>2.1.14. Ba\u015fvurunun toplam tutar\u0131 kontrol edilerek ve yukarda hesaplanan de\u011ferler kullan\u0131larak laboratuvarlar s\u0131ralan\u0131r.<\/p>\n<p>2.1.15. Ba\u015fvuru tutar\u0131 2500 TL\u2019den d\u00fc\u015f\u00fck veya e\u015fit ise, hesaplamaya kat\u0131lan laboratuvarlardan \u00f6ncelikle son puan\u0131 pozitif olanlar se\u00e7ilir. Se\u00e7ilen laboratuvarlar, tesise olan ula\u015f\u0131m s\u00fcrelerine g\u00f6re s\u0131ralan\u0131r. En yak\u0131n laboratuvarlar da kendi i\u00e7lerinde son puanlar\u0131na g\u00f6re s\u0131ralan\u0131r ve birinci laboratuvar se\u00e7ilir.<\/p>\n<p>2.1.16. Ba\u015fvuru tutar\u0131 2500 TL\u2019den y\u00fcksek, 7500 TL\u2019den d\u00fc\u015f\u00fck veya e\u015fit ise, hesaplamaya kat\u0131lan laboratuvarlardan \u00f6ncelikle son puan\u0131 pozitif olanlar se\u00e7ilir. Se\u00e7ilen laboratuvarlardan d\u00fczeltme puan\u0131 pozitif olanlar se\u00e7ilir. Se\u00e7ilen laboratuvarlar, tesise olan ula\u015f\u0131m s\u00fcrelerine g\u00f6re s\u0131ralan\u0131r. En yak\u0131n laboratuvarlar da kendi i\u00e7lerinde son puanlar\u0131na g\u00f6re s\u0131ralan\u0131r ve birinci laboratuvar se\u00e7ilir.<\/p>\n<p>2.1.17. Ba\u015fvuru tutar\u0131 7500 TL\u2019den y\u00fcksek ise, hesaplamaya kat\u0131lan laboratuvarlardan \u00f6ncelikle son puan\u0131 pozitif olanlar se\u00e7ilir. Se\u00e7ilen laboratuvarlar son puanlar\u0131na g\u00f6re s\u0131ralan\u0131r. Birden fazla laboratuvar\u0131n son puan\u0131 e\u015fit ise, bu laboratuvarlar tesise olan ula\u015f\u0131m s\u00fcrelerine g\u00f6re s\u0131ralan\u0131r. Birden fazla laboratuvar\u0131n tesise olan ula\u015f\u0131m s\u00fcresi ayn\u0131 ise, bu laboratuvarlar kapsam sapma tutarlar\u0131na g\u00f6re s\u0131ralan\u0131r ve birinci laboratuvar se\u00e7ilir.<\/p>\n<p>2.1.18. Ba\u015fvuruda dioksin ve furan parametresi varsa ve birince se\u00e7ilen laboratuvar bu parametreden analiz konusunda yetkilendirilmemi\u015f ise, bu parametrenin analizinde yetkili ve hesaplamaya kat\u0131lan di\u011fer laboratuvarlar incelenir. Bu laboratuvarlardan en y\u00fcksek puana sahip olan ve puan\u0131 birinci gelen laboratuvar\u0131n puan\u0131ndan en fazla %40 d\u00fc\u015f\u00fck olan laboratuvar se\u00e7ilir ve ba\u015fvuru i\u00e7in bu laboratuvar g\u00f6revlendirilir. %40 puan kriterini sa\u011flayan bir laboratuvar bulunamad\u0131ysa, birinci se\u00e7ilen fakat analiz yetene\u011fi olmayan laboratuvar g\u00f6revlendirilir.<\/p>\n<div><br \/>\n<em>Melbes Algoritma<\/em><\/div>\n<h4>2.2.
